COVID-19 Protocols in Kigali

  • Pre-arrival:
    • All costs (tests, accomodation, transport, etc) will be covered by the traveller. Please see payment methods here.
    • All travellers to Rwanda will be required to show proof of a negative COVID-19 RT-PCR test (Real Time Polymerase Reaction from an ISO-certified laboratory), taken within 120 hours of departure for Rwanda. The results from this test must be submitted to the Rwanda Development Board before departing the country of origin and needs to be shown on arrival in the country.
    • Prior to departure, the Passenger Locator Form (PLF) must be completed and the COVID-19 test certificate uploaded in this link.
    • This page will issue a reference number that will be given to health authorities on arrival. All traveller information will be available on the PLF including the hotel they will be staying at on arrival.
  • Arrival into Rwanda:
    • A second mandatory RT-PCR test will be conducted upon arrival in Kigali to confirm the negative results of the test taken prior to arrival. Note that this will require a minimum of one overnight (24 hours) stay in a designated Kigali hotel while awaiting results. Costs for testing and accommodation are to be covered by the traveller.
    • If travellers are unable to get the first test prior to departure from their country of origin, they will be required to take two tests in Rwanda, allowing for a 48 hour period between tests. The cost of these is US$ 50 per person per test.
    • Sanitary protocols are followed at the airport, and travellers will be accompanied through baggage collection all the way to the vehicle for their transfer to the hotel.
    • COVID-19 tests will be conducted at the hotel by health authorities, where a dedicated COVID-19 desk will be occupied 24/7. An additional medical service fee of US$ 10 will be charged at the hotel to conduct a test. 
  • On leaving Rwanda:
    • A test on departure is compulsory and will cost US$ 50.

Sim Cards

MTN, Airtel-Tigo and KTRN are the 3 main mobile network providers in Rwanda. You may purchase SIM cards from the airport or from any authorised sellers in the city. Please have your ID (Passport) handy when going to get a SIM card.

 

Banks & ATMs

You will find ATMs at the airport and banks at the airport, Kigali Heights and various secured locations in the city.

 

Exchange Rates

There are several Forex Bureaus in the city. You can change money at Universal Money (UNIMONI) at Kigali Heights or any other Forex Bureau in the city. You may also change money at the airport provided you arrive before 11pm Kigali time. Kindly carry your passport if you plan on using Forex.

About Rwanda

Rwanda, or the Land of a Thousand Hills, as it is popularly known due its mountanous terrain, is a picturesque country that is home to exceptional natural beauty and the warmest people. Among its nature showstoppers are the dormant volcanoes found in the northwest of Rwanda in the Volcanoes National park. Lake Kivu is another beauty and is the 6th largest lake on the continent, bordering the DRC. Rwanda's laid back back urban capita, Kigali, is considered one of the safest and cleanest cities on the continent, and a first choice location for international events and conferences. 

 

Culture

Rwanda represents a harmonious combination of the past, present and the future. As one of the fastest growing economies in Africa, Rwanda is fast becoming a hub of innovation, however, still holding on to its heritage. Rwandan cultural elements are steeped into the fabric of the country, which is most evident in the design. One of the country's most iconic landmarks, the Kigali Convention Center, was inspired by the traditional king's palace which graduation attendees can visit in Nyanza. The traditional geometric imigongo design also features Rwandan design, from architecture to fashion.
